TNK2 protein, human

Known as: TNK2, Activated CDC42 kinase 1, activated Cdc42-associated kinase 1 protein, human 
Activated CDC42 kinase 1 (1038 aa, ~115 kDa) is encoded by the human TNK2 gene. This protein is involved in tyrosine phosphorylation, endocytosis and…
